Liability Insurance: Shielding You from Financial Responsibility
Liability insurance is a cornerstone of full auto protection, designed to shield policyholders from financial responsibility in case they cause damage to others’ property or injure someone else during an accident. This coverage pays for the other party’s medical expenses and repairs to their vehicle, up to the limits specified in your policy. With the increasing number of uninsured drivers on the road, liability insurance becomes even more crucial. It acts as a safety net, protecting you from potential lawsuits and substantial out-of-pocket expenses that could arise from an accident with an uninsured or underinsured motorist.
In many cases, liability insurance is divided into two main parts: bodily injury liability and property damage liability. Bodily injury liability covers medical costs for injured parties, while property damage liability pays for repairs or replacement of damaged property. This dual protection ensures that you’re covered comprehensively if you’re found at fault in an accident, providing peace of mind as you navigate the complexities of the road.
Collision Coverage: Protecting Your Vehicle in Accidental Encounters
Collision coverage is a crucial component of full auto protection, designed to safeguard your vehicle from physical damage during accidents. This coverage kicks in when you’re involved in a collision with another vehicle or even a fixed object like a tree or fence. It helps cover the costs of repairing or replacing your car, up to its actual cash value. By having this protection, you can rest assured that financial surprises from unexpected crashes won’t put a strain on your finances.

Comprehensive Insurance: Broadest Defense Against Perils
Comprehensive insurance offers the broadest defense against a wide range of perils, from natural disasters to theft and vandalism. Unlike liability and collision coverage, which primarily focus on protecting you in the event of an accident with other drivers, comprehensive insurance covers damages to your own vehicle, regardless of who’s at fault. This includes damage from fire, theft, vandalism, and even weather events like hailstorms or flooding.
While it may seem like an additional cost, comprehensive insurance acts as a safety net, shielding you from substantial financial burdens that could arise from these unexpected events.
